Decoding Your A1C: What the results indicate
Your A1C measurement provides a picture of your average blood sugar figures over the past three months – it's much more just a single glucose check. A normal A1C is generally below 5.7%, and levels falling 5.7% and 6.4% suggest prediabetes. An A1C of 6.5% or greater usually signals diabetes. It's crucial to understand your specific A1C number with your physician to create a individualized treatment plan and monitor your improvement.
The Way Glycated Hemoglobin Is and Which It Shows The Result?
The HbA1c measurement gives a overview of average blood sugar over the last 2-3 period. Basically, it quantifies the portion of blood cells that is bound to glucose. Glucose adheres to hemoglobin, and the higher your typical blood sugar levels, the higher this glycation occurs. Healthcare providers analyze the glycated hemoglobin reading to assess high blood sugar and evaluate the effectiveness of glucose control plans. Normal values read more differ but generally, a decreased A1C indicates more effective blood sugar management.
